如何查询没有选课的学号是一个常见的问题,这篇文章将介绍一种简单的方法在MysqL数据库中查询没有选课的学号。
1. 创建一个包含所有学生学号的表ts”的表:
id INT NOT NULL AUTO_INCREMENT,t_id VARCHAR(20) NOT NULL,
PRIMARY KEY (id)
2. 创建一个包含所有选课学生学号的表
接下来,需要创建一个包含所有选课学生学号的表。可以通过以下sql语句创建一个名为“selected_courses”的表:
CREATE TABLE selected_courses (
id INT NOT NULL AUTO_INCREMENT,
course_id VARCHAR(20) NOT NULL,
PRIMARY KEY (id)
3. 查询没有选课的学号
查询没有选课的学号可以通过使用“LEFT JOIN”和“WHERE”语句来实现。以下是查询没有选课的学号的sql语句:
tst_idtststt_idt_id IS NULL;
解释ts”表与“selected_courses”表连接起来。然后使用“WHERE”语句过滤出没有选课的学号。
通过以上方法,可以轻松查询没有选课的学号。这种方法适用于各种类型的MysqL数据库,包括MysqL 5.7和MysqL 8.0等版本。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。